Chotto GhettoChotto Ghetto: RampageRampage (2007)Quote Unquote Records Reviewer Rating: 3 User Rating: Contributed by: FuzzyJustin (others by this writer | submit your own) Chotto Ghetto are a hardcore-ish band from southern California. I say hardcore-ish since the band fuses elements of hardcore, melody, bouncing rhythms and spazz-osity into their music. The four-song EP opens with "Rhythmic Violence," which has a bouncy, sing-along chorus that seems to long for a .
